What Is Workers’ Comp Physical Therapy?
Workers’ comp physical therapy is a specialized type of rehabilitation designed to help employees recover after being injured on the job. Its purpose is to help you regain strength, mobility, and functional ability, allowing for a safe transition back to your job and everyday routine.
If you’re dealing with pain, stiffness, or loss of function from a work-related injury, physical therapy can help you heal and rebuild confidence in your mobility and function. 2. Customized Treatment Plan
After your initial assessment, our Lake St. Louis, MO team will create a rehab plan personalized to your injury and job demands.
- Targeted exercises to restore muscle function and stamina
- Manual therapy to reduce pain and restore motion
- Task-specific training to prepare you for safe job re-entry
- Therapeutic techniques such as heat, ice, stim, dry needling, soft tissue work, or Kinesio Taping® to support your recovery
- Advanced Work Rehabilitation programs to simulate real job tasks and ensure safe return-to-duty readiness for physically demanding roles

Coverage & Eligibility for Workers’ Comp PT in Lake St. Louis, MO
Workers’ comp often covers physical therapy, provided it’s prescribed by your Lake St. Louis, MO physician and directly tied to your workplace injury. Axes PT is here to guide you through every part of the approval and treatment process.
How Do I Get Approved?
- See a Doctor – You’ll need a referral from a doctor to begin therapy under workers’ comp.
- Get Preauthorization – Approval from your employer’s insurance provider is required before you can start.
- Schedule Quickly – Once authorized, you can schedule your therapy—often within 24–48 hours at Axes.
Our team communicates with your case manager or adjuster to manage all necessary documentation, letting you concentrate on recovery. Not sure if you qualify? Contact us, and we’ll explain your options clearly—without offering legal guidance.
What Happens If You’re Not Cleared for Full Duty?
If additional verification is needed before going back to work, we offer FCEs to evaluate your capabilities. These detailed assessments measure your ability to safely perform job tasks and provide objective data for return-to-work or legal decisions.

Frequently Asked Questions About Workers’ Comp Physical Therapy
How do I get my physical therapy covered by workers’ comp?
Coverage starts with a doctor’s referral and approval from your employer’s workers’ comp insurance provider.
Once your physician recommends PT, your case manager or adjuster must authorize the sessions. Our team takes care of the paperwork and communication so you can focus on healing.
What types of injuries qualify for workers’ comp physical therapy?
Any job-related injury that limits movement, causes discomfort, or affects your ability to work may qualify for PT.
Injuries like back strains, whiplash, joint sprains, tendonitis, post-surgical care, and repetitive stress injuries are commonly treated. Therapy is customized to match your work duties and recovery goals.
Do I need to choose a clinic from a list?
It depends on your employer’s workers’ comp policy and your state’s rules.
In Missouri, your employer or insurer may direct your care to certain providers. That said, many patients are able to request care at a trusted clinic like Axes—just ask your adjuster or contact us for help.
How long will my workers’ comp physical therapy last?
Your recovery timeline will depend on the severity of your injury, your job’s demands, and your body’s response to treatment.
Some people recover in a few weeks; others need a few months. Your therapist will track your progress closely and adjust your plan as needed to ensure a safe, effective return to work.
Do I need a lawyer to start PT under workers’ comp?
A lawyer isn’t necessary to begin PT, but one may be useful if there’s a dispute or delay in your claim.
